Output 66158f7398d4996fb8693b2f519ec5584b05fdc6a05b719a981cd14a656e3fd2:1

value
2354383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a28a6b5989af0d12cb3ff842200c8b128bb115b9 OP_EQUAL
address
3GWTDAUuNmXbP9ehr15shVfEu7obwWEdxs
transaction
66158f7398d4996fb8693b2f519ec5584b05fdc6a05b719a981cd14a656e3fd2
spent
true